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of electrophoretic coating technology, and in particular to a workpiece frame for an electrophoretic coating tank. Background Technology

[0002] Electrophoretic coating is a coating method that uses an external electric field to cause pigments and resin particles suspended in an electrophoretic solution to migrate directionally and deposit on the surface of a substrate, which is one of the electrodes. Currently, the appearance quality of a product not only reflects its protective and decorative performance, but is also an important factor in the product's value. Therefore, high-efficiency electrophoretic coating is one of the key factors in realizing the value of a product.

[0003] Currently, electrophoretic coating generally involves moving the basket up and down to agitate the electrophoretic solution near the product. However, during this up-and-down movement, the basket often shifts, making it impossible to move it accurately and effectively. This results in uneven coating of the workpiece and affects the coating effect.

[0004] To address this issue, a workpiece frame for electrophoretic coating tanks is proposed, which offers the advantage of uniform coating and thus solves the problems mentioned in the background art. Utility Model Content

[0006]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ention adopts the following technical solution: a workpiece frame for an electrophoretic coating tank, comprising a mounting frame, a lifting rod, and a suspension frame. A connecting sleeve is integrally provided in the middle of the mounting frame, and a lifting rod is inserted inside the connecting sleeve. A first motor is fixed on the top surface of the mounting frame, and a gear is fixed on the output end of the first motor. A rack is welded to the left side wall of the lifting rod, and the rack meshes with the gear at the output end of the first motor. A guide strip is welded to the surface of the lifting rod, and a guide groove is provided on the inner ring of the connecting sleeve corresponding to the guide strip. A fixing box is welded to the bottom of the lifting rod, and a second motor is fixedly installed inside the fixing box. A suspension frame is fixedly installed on the output end of the second motor, and two workpiece placement trays are welded to the lower surface of the suspension frame. A suspension ring is welded to each workpiece placement tray of the suspension frame, and several workpiece hooks are welded to both the inner and outer rings of the suspension ring.

[0007] As a further description of the above technical solution: the surface of the workpiece placement tray is welded with an annular pocket, and the annular pocket is located directly below the suspension ring, and a connecting rod is welded between the annular pocket and the suspension ring. The surface of the workpiece placement tray is provided with several holes, and the annular pocket is made of metal wire mesh.

[0008] As a further description of the above technical solution: a mounting plate is welded to both the left and right ends of the mounting bracket, and screw holes are opened on the surface of the mounting plate.

[0009] As a further description of the above technical solution: a number of guide strips are welded to the surface of the lifting rod, and a number of guide grooves are opened in the inner ring of the connecting sleeve corresponding to the guide strips. Lubricating grease is provided between the guide strips and the guide grooves.

[0010] As a further description of the above technical solution: the suspension frame is composed of a central shaft and two workpiece mounting discs welded to its surface, and the central shaft of the suspension frame is fixedly connected to the output end of the second motor through a coupling.

[0011] As a further description of the above technical solution: a maintenance opening is provided on the outer surface of the fixed box, and a sealing cover is fixedly installed in the maintenance opening by screws.

[0012] This utility model has the following beneficial effects:

[0013] In this invention, a lifting rod is inserted into the connecting sleeve of the mounting frame, and a suspension frame is connected to the bottom of the lifting rod via a fixed box. By starting the first motor on the mounting frame, the first motor drives the gear to rotate in both forward and reverse directions. Since the lifting rod is connected to the gear through a rack and pinion and is slidably connected to the guide groove in the connecting sleeve through several guide bars, the lifting rod can smoothly drive the suspension frame to perform reciprocating lifting and lowering motion. On this basis, by starting the second motor in the fixed box, the suspension frame is driven to rotate in both forward and reverse directions, so that the product on the suspension frame performs forward and reverse rotation motion while reciprocating lifting and lowering. This satisfies the need for agitation of the electrophoretic liquid near the product and facilitates uniform coating of the product.

[0014] In this invention, an annular sump is welded and installed on the workpiece placement tray of the suspension frame, with the annular sump positioned directly below the suspension ring. When the product suspended on the surface of the suspension ring falls off during the electrophoresis stage, the product falls directly into the annular sump. Combined with the hollow structure of the annular sump, this design satisfies the requirement of product suspension and electrophoresis while preventing the product from being difficult to retrieve after it detaches from the workpiece placement tray. [0028] Working principle:

[0029] In use, the mounting frame 1 is first fixed in the electrophoresis equipment, and the suspension frame 10 is suspended or immersed in the electrophoresis pool of the electrophoresis equipment. Before electrophoresis, the product is hung on the suspension ring 13 of the suspension frame 10. By starting the first motor 4 on the mounting frame 1, the first motor 4 drives the gear 5 to rotate in both forward and reverse directions. Since the lifting rod 3 is connected to the gear 5 through the rack 7 and the lifting rod 3 is slidably connected to the guide groove 15 in the connecting sleeve 2 through several guide bars 6, the lifting rod 3 can smoothly drive the suspension frame 10 to perform reciprocating lifting and lowering movements. On this basis, by starting the second motor 9 in the fixed box 8, the suspension frame 10 is driven to rotate in both forward and reverse directions, so that the product on the suspension frame 10 performs forward and reverse rotation movements while reciprocating lifting and lowering. This satisfies the agitation of the electrophoresis liquid near the product and facilitates uniform coating of the product. When the product suspended on the surface of the suspension ring 13 falls off during the electrophoresis stage, the product falls directly into the annular hopper 12, avoiding the situation where the product is difficult to retrieve after falling off the workpiece placement tray 11.
